Legendary 10 Corso Como, the Milanese concept store founded little over thirty years ago by the equally legendary Carla Sozzani, has raised its profile in the Lombardian capital with a pop-up store at Stazione Milano Centrale. Needless to say, it’s Milan Fashion Week, and 10 Corso Como goes the extra yard, reaching out to the 350,000 daily commuters with a curated selection of offerings. Mind you, the store has catered to travellers since it first opened its doors, so the ephemeral retail space very much spawns from a tradition. Situated in the venue’s Galleria dei Mosaici, on the platform level, it’s housed in a glass-encased pavilion marked with the store’s name and logo.

So, what’s in stock? On the shelves of the 10 Corso Como pop-up store shoppers will find various accessories, shopping bags, handbags, trousseau and candles made in collaboration with top Italian and international ateliers, alongside a wide range of Italian delicacies, ranging from with pasta and rice, to olive oil from Liguria and Tuscan gin, all in gift boxes in the store’s signature black and white graphics (open through Oct 30). The newest temporary 10 Corso Como retail space follows pop-ups in Forte dei Marmi in 2022 and at the Forte Village resort on Sardinia earlier this year, and is the starting point of the new 10 Corso Como travel retail division that will focus on new retail projects across the planet.
